Los Laureles is located 70 kilometers north of Paraná city, in the province of Entre Ríos.
Surrounded by rivers and white sand beaches, Los Laureles is a fly fishing paradise. Its direct access to the Paraná river assures a remarkable experience for fishing the golden dorado, freshwater fish native to South America, renown for its fighting and unequalled jumping skills.

The hunting and fishing areas which we select, are located to the north-west of Buenos Aires, in the provinces of Santa Fe and Entre Ríos, on the coast of the Paraná river, the largest of the Argentine rivers. Swamps, estuaries, lagoons, islands and rice cultivations make from these areas a real paradise for anatids found by hundreds throughout thousands of hectares.
Hunts will take place within a radio not further than 45 minutes from Los Laureles where our guests lodge. Our organisation provides skilled hunting and fishing guides, dogs trained both for duck and partridge hunting, and the appropriate vehicles and boats for transportation. It is worthwhile mentioning that since this area is next to the Paraná river, with all its ramifications, those who are fond of fishing will be able to practice this sport (Fly, Spinning & Traditional methods available).
We provide all the necessary equipment for traditional methods, including our own boats, for the fishing of dorados, surubíes, patíes, manduvíes, and several other species of the Paraná river.
The fishing lodge is strictly catch & release.

Useful inforamtion for anglers going to Los Laureles
Fishing the golden dorado-freshwater fish native to South America, renown for its fighting and unequalled jumping skills- is a remarkable experience.
In Los Laureles, we use fly rods and light spinning tackle to go after the golden dorado. Modern and efficient Carolina Skiff boats are utilized as they provide ideal platforms to cast from. The fishing lodge is strictly catch & release.

Good to know
What documentation is needed?
Besides the passport, there are some extra documents needed in order to entry the country with firearms and ammunitions. Before traveling it is necessary to submit an application at the argentine consulate in the country of origin, requiring the "temporary authorization and temporary possess permit" of corresponding material during the stay in Argentina. This consular permit will be asked when arriving and leaving. We are able to accelerate the proceeding in Customs. For this, it is only needed to send by fax in advance the mentioned authorization.
What to bring?
In winter, from June to September, it is recommended to bring sweaters, gloves, short boots and waders, a good wind-breaking jacket, rain jacket and warm clothes. During summer, from December to March, clothes should be light. Don't forget to bring solar protection and mosquito repellent.

Los Laureles, Entré Ríos.
The river Paraná divides the provinces of Entre Rios and Santa Fe and provides very good conditions for many birds that bread in the provinces.
To get to Los Laureles you can take a 45 min flight into Paraná airport in Entré Rios, the capital city of the province. Paraná airport is in only 40 min driving distance from the lodge. Charter plane to the area in only 15 min driving distance from the lodge. Another option is a
1 hour flight from Buenos Aires and 1 ½ hour drive from Santa Fe airport to the lodge.
